Not necessarily a full build from scratch per se, but its requiring enough custom fitting I figured this thread would find a good home here.

Started life as a 14.5" pinned and welded .223 Wylde. Shot great, but I wanted something a bit more multipurpose that I could take hunting. That's when I started looking into the 6.5. The rest was history.

Proof 20" 6.5G
JP Enhanced Bolt
Superlative Arms "Bleed Off" Gas Block
AAC Blackout FH
Nightforce Beast 5-25
Spuhr 4003b

Fresh out of the box


Barrel swapped


A little 5-axis mill work to clear the gas block



By the skin of my teeth...


Scope mounted


The gas block still does not clear the rail when you seat it onto the upper receiver since the block height is not concentric about the bore axis. I need to get it back up on the machine to mill out a .250" x 4" slot on the topside of the forward end of the rail. Once that's done, I'll coat all the exposed aluminum and be ready to shoot.

So I had to bail on the adjustable gas block and just throw on a Troy low profile block in order to clear the hand guard. Even with milling a slot in the top, the block and gas tube still hit.



Also wound up taking off the Beast because it was just too much scope for the rifle. In search of a replacement.
